What Is a 14K Solid Gold Chain?

A 14K solid gold chain is made from gold that contains 58.3% pure gold, mixed with stronger metals such as silver, copper, or zinc. This combination creates jewelry that is both beautiful and durable.

Unlike gold-plated or gold-filled jewelry, a solid gold chain contains real gold throughout the entire piece. It will not peel, chip, or wear away over time, making it an excellent choice for daily use.

Because of its strength and lasting value, 14K gold has become one of the most popular choices for necklaces, bracelets, and other fine jewelry.

What Affects the 14K Solid Gold Chain Price?

Several factors determine the 14k solid gold chain price. Understanding these factors allows buyers to compare products more accurately instead of focusing only on the listed price.

1. Gold Market Price

Gold prices change daily based on international markets. When the value of gold increases, jewelry prices also rise.

Since every solid gold chain contains real gold, fluctuations in the gold market directly affect its cost.

2. Weight of the Chain

The heavier the chain, the more gold it contains.

For example:

  • Lightweight chains generally cost less.
  • Medium-weight chains offer a balance of comfort and value.
  • Heavy chains require significantly more gold, making them more expensive.

Weight is often measured in grams, making it one of the biggest pricing factors.

3. Chain Style

Different chain styles require different levels of craftsmanship.

Popular styles include:

  • Cable Chains
  • Rope Chains
  • Cuban Chains
  • Figaro Chains
  • Box Chains
  • Wheat Chains
  • Snake Chains

More detailed designs usually require additional labor, which can increase the overall price.

4. Width and Thickness

A wider chain contains more gold than a thinner one.

For example:

  • 1mm chains are delicate and lightweight.
  • 3mm chains provide a balanced everyday look.
  • 6mm and above create a bold statement and naturally cost more.

5. Length

Chain length also impacts pricing.

Common lengths include:

  • 16 inches
  • 18 inches
  • 20 inches
  • 22 inches
  • 24 inches
  • 30 inches

Longer chains require more gold, increasing the total price.

Popular Types of Solid Gold Chains

There are many beautiful Solid Gold Chains available to match different styles and preferences.

Rope Chain

The rope chain features twisted links that reflect light beautifully.

Best for:

  • Everyday wear
  • Pendants
  • Layering

Cuban Chain

Known for its bold appearance, the Cuban chain remains one of the most popular styles for both men and women.

Ideal for:

  • Fashion statements
  • Luxury looks
  • Standalone wear

Figaro Chain

This Italian-inspired design combines short and long links for a unique appearance.

Perfect for:

  • Casual outfits
  • Formal occasions
  • Pendant necklaces

Box Chain

Box chains feature square links that create a smooth, modern appearance.

Advantages include:

  • Strong construction
  • Elegant look
  • Excellent support for pendants

Cable Chain

One of the most classic styles, cable chains consist of simple round or oval links.

They offer:

  • Timeless style
  • Lightweight comfort
  • Everyday versatility

How to Verify a Genuine 14K Gold Chain

Before purchasing, always verify authenticity.

Look for:

  • 14K hallmark
  • 585 stamp
  • Quality clasp
  • Smooth finishing
  • Trusted jewelry retailer

Buying from a reputable jeweler helps ensure you're getting genuine gold.

Caring for Your Solid Gold Chain

Proper care helps maintain your jewelry's beauty for many years.

Simple care tips include:

  • Store separately to avoid scratches.
  • Clean regularly with mild soap and warm water.
  • Dry with a soft microfiber cloth.
  • Avoid harsh household chemicals.
  • Remove jewelry before heavy physical activities.

Regular maintenance keeps your chain looking as beautiful as the day you purchased it.
